Anti-nuclear protesters stage a demonstration near the Hiroshima Peace Memorial Park on August 6, 2012, as the city marks the 67th anniversary of the first atomic bomb dropped by the United States on August 6, 1945, killing an estimated 70,000 people instantly with many thousands more dying over the following years from the effects of radiation. Three days later another atomic bomb was dropped on Nagasaki.
